Azzura revamps billionaire's cat

Refined comfort for Richard Branson's luxury catamaran

Virgin boss Sir Richard Branson has had his latest toy revamped by Azzura Marine at its state-of-the-art yard in the industrial NSW city of Newcastle.


The impressive 32 metre long catamaran Necker Belle (which was previously Lady Barbaretta) will be sailed 10,000 nautical miles to Branson's Necker Island in the Caribbean when she completes sea trials.


The yacht will be available for charter to Branson's guests on his private island.


The Necker Belle has had a major refit and refurbishment at the Azzura yard: the sailing systems have been upgraded, new sails installed, and a new mast, measuring 38 metres, installed. The yacht now should be able to reach 25 knots under sail.


An extra guest cabin was added within the 14 metre beam of the carbon-fibre yacht.


During the refit, a salt water tower was constructed within the Azzura shed so all the major systems, including engines and generators, could be fully load tested while the yacht was out of the water.


The refit is a continuation of Azzura's growing reputation in the super yacht world for their skill and efficiency.


The interior of Necker Belle was redesigned by AM Interiors, Azzura Marine's interiors division, which recently did the interior design for the acclaimed Hamilton Island Yacht Club.
